Black Mold Remediation in Essex County, NJ
Black mold remediation services focus on identifying and safely removing mold growth caused by excess moisture or water intrusion within residential properties. These projects typically involve inspecting affected areas such as basements, bathrooms, attics, or behind walls, and then employing specialized techniques to eliminate mold colonies, prevent their return, and restore indoor air quality. Homeowners often seek this service when noticing visible mold, musty odors, or experiencing health symptoms linked to mold exposure, and they usually want to understand the scope of work, potential causes of mold growth, and the importance of proper removal to ensure a healthy living environment.
Before requesting black mold remediation, property owners should be aware that successful mold removal requires addressing underlying moisture issues, such as leaks or high humidity levels. It’s important to understand which areas are affected, the extent of the mold growth, and any potential health risks involved. Proper containment and thorough cleaning are essential to prevent spores from spreading to other parts of the home. Clarifying these details can help homeowners make informed decisions about the scope of the project and ensure that the remediation process effectively restores a safe, mold-free space.

Black Mold Remediation Questions
What is black mold remediation? Black mold remediation involves identifying and removing mold growth to improve indoor air quality and prevent health issues.
What types of properties need black mold removal? Homes, apartments, and commercial buildings with visible mold or moisture problems may require black mold removal services.
How can I tell if I have black mold? Signs include musty odors, visible black or dark green patches, and symptoms like allergies or respiratory irritation.
What areas are commonly affected by black mold? Common areas include bathrooms, basements, attics, and areas with water leaks or high humidity levels.
